Vocabulary from this episode

 

Nada Go-Go: Indicating the so-called 5 villages of Nada. From
east to west, they are Nishi, Mikage, Uozaki, Nishinomiya and Imazu.

Kudari-zake: Sake that was ‘’sent down’’ from the Kamigata
region (modern-day Kyoto and the surrounding vicinity) during the Edo period.
